Best Sandals Resorts for Honeymoons in 2026
Sandals Dunn's River (Jamaica) is best for couples who want nature, adventure, and the classic Caribbean energy of Jamaica
Sandals St. Vincent (Bequia Island) is best for couples who want total privacy, seclusion, and ultra-luxury on the newest Sandals property
Sandals LaSource (Grenada) is best for couples who want a mix of tropical adventure and pure relaxation on the Spice Isle
All three are couples-only, all-inclusive, and include private beach dinners, spa treatments, and butler service at select suite categories
Price ranges from mid-high at Dunn's River to premium at St. Vincent
All three require a valid US passport for at least six months beyond your travel dates

When couples tell me they want natural beauty, great energy, and that classic Caribbean spirit, I point them straight to Dunn's River. This resort sits in Ocho Rios, Jamaica, surrounded by lush jungle, cascading waterfalls, and a coastline that genuinely takes your breath away the first time you see it.
What I love most about this property is that it earns its name. You are minutes away from Dunn's River Falls, one of the most iconic natural landmarks in the entire Caribbean, and the resort itself feels like it was designed to match that natural setting. The water activities are excellent, every where you look is an Instagram worthy picture, and the energy on the island is always warm and alive in a way only Jamaican can be.

From a logistics standpoint, it is one of the easier Sandals properties to get to. Transfer time from Ocho Rios is about 15 to 20 minutes, which means you land, you get settled, and your honeymoon starts fast. No half-day lost in a van.
I recommend Dunn's River to couples who want adventure alongside romance. If your idea of a perfect honeymoon includes doing things together, hiking, snorkeling, exploring, and then coming back to an incredible resort to celebrate, this is your place.

Sandals St. Vincent is the newest property in the entire portfolio, set on Bequia Island in St. Vincent and the Grenadines, one of the most unspoiled, breathtaking corners of the Caribbean.
This resort is not trying to be a party. It is intentionally intimate, meticulously designed, and built for couples who want to feel genuinely tucked away from the rest of the world. The beaches are pristine. The vibe is quiet and luxurious in a way that feels intentional.
Getting there does take a little more planning. Often there is an overnight stay in Miami before you can fly to St. Vincent. You fly into St. Vincent and then ferry over or use the Sandals transfers and see the island. I can tell you the ferry is a calm ride where you are surrounded by turquoise water, where as the transfer by car will have you going through some twist and turns. If you take the ferry, as you leave the dock all your worries fade away and when you arrive you are ready to enjoy the resort and all it has to offer.
When couples tell me their top priority is privacy and that they want to feel like they are the only two people on the island, I send them here every single time. This is the most exclusive honeymoon experience in the current Sandals lineup, and it shows.

Sandals LaSource sits on a stunning stretch of beach in what locals call the Spice Isle, and that nickname tells you everything. There is a richness to Grenada, with its culture, landscape, reefs, and markets. This adds character to any honeymoon experience that you simply do not get at from any other Caribbean destination. You can snorkel over vibrant coral, explore waterfalls, wander through spice gardens, or plant yourself on the beach and do absolutely nothing. LaSource makes all of it equally easy.
What I like most about this resort for honeymooners is the balance. Some couples want full relaxation. Some want adventure. Most want both, and they feel guilty choosing. LaSource removes that guilt entirely. You can have both in the same week, sometimes in the same afternoon. Transfer time from the airport is about 25 to 35 minutes, and Grenada has good flights from multiple US cities, so getting there is pretty straightforward.
Honeymoon Perks at Each Resort
This is one of my favorite things to walk couples through, because Sandals does honeymoon extras well, and all three of these properties include perks that genuinely feel special.
Across all three resorts, you can expect private romantic dinners on the beach, complimentary couples spa treatments at select room categories, honeymoon turndown service with all the rose petals and sparkling wine you would hope for, and butler service at higher suite levels. Debating on the butler service, imagine having someone who is handling your restaurant reservations, arranging your excursions, and checking in to make sure everything is perfect. It completely changes the experience.
What I always tell my clients is that the perks you actually receive depend heavily on which room category you book. Not all categories are equal, and this is exactly the kind of detail I help couples navigate before they ever hit the book button. Getting the right room unlocks the right experience.

FAQ
Is Sandals actually worth the price for a honeymoon? In my experience, yes, and here is why. The all-inclusive model means you pay once and spend your honeymoon actually present with each other instead of watching the bill climb at every meal and excursion. For couples who want a high-service, stress-free experience, Sandals consistently delivers. I would not keep booking it for my clients if it did not.
Which of these three Sandals resorts is the most romantic? All three are genuinely romantic, but if I am being direct with you, Sandals St. Vincent takes it for couples who define romance as total privacy. It is newer, quieter, and designed with an intimacy that feels rare even among luxury resorts.
Do Sandals resorts allow children? No, and that is a feature, not a bug. Sandals is couples-only and adults-only across every property. No children anywhere. For a honeymoon, that matters more than people realize until they are actually there.
How far in advance should we book? I tell my couples 9 to 12 months out, especially if you are looking at peak travel times like summer or the holidays. The suite categories that include the best perks fill up fast, and booking early usually means better rate options too.
Do we need to book excursions separately? Some excursions are included and some are add-ons depending on your room category and the property. Off-resort experiences like visiting Dunn's River Falls or a Grenada spice tour are typically separate bookings.
